Checking your IBM HTTP Server version

At times, you might need to determine the version of your IBM HTTP Server installation.

  1. Change directory to the installation root of the Web server. For example, this is /opt/IBMHTTPD on a Solaris machine.

  2. Find the subdirectory that contains apache.exe (on a Windows platforms) or apachectl (on a UNIX-based platforms, such as z/OS, Solaris, Linux, and HP-UX)

  3. On a Windows platform, issue

    apache.exe -V
    

  4. On a UNIX-based platforms issue

    ./apachectl -V 4
    

The version is shown in the "Server version:" field and will looks something like the following

Server version: IBM_HTTP_Server/2.0.47 Apache/2.0.47 
Server built: Oct 2 2003 20:38:36 
Server's Module Magic Number: 20020903:4.
